"The Aim of this article is to inform (Geodesy and Cartography) community about Military Engineer Information (MEI) Needs/Requirements during the process of planning of military engineer tasks according to basic NATO Military Engineer Agreements. The Authors suppose, that specifying and presentation of MEI needs would contribute to the further improvement of MEI systems, mainly Geografic Informaton Systems (GIS) and additional tools which should more reflect specialities of this broad area. Within The Czech Army, Geodesy and Cartography is not an integral part of Military Engineering, resources are limited and so it is not so easy to have an influence on the development of GIS or GIS based tools." .
